the Roaring Trowmen at The Greenbank Pub

A gig on Saturday 10th December. The event starts at 19:30.


Four hearty men who sing sea shanties and songs of the salty deep! 'the Roaring Trowmen' celebrate the working songs sung by sailors around the world which have endured the test of time. Hear old favorites combined with original new songs, delivered with passion, energy and plenty of silly banter!
